The concept and types of social conflicts

A social conflict always contains a moment of collision, that is, there is a certain discrepancy, a contradiction of interests and positions of the parties. Opposing opinions are the subjects of the conflict - the warring parties. They seek to overcome the contradiction in one way or another, while each side wants to prevent the other from realizing its interests. The concept of conflict in social psychology extends not only to social groups. Depending on the subject, conflicts are distinguished:

  • intrapersonal;
  • interpersonal
  • intergroup.

Also included in social conflicts is the concept of internal content, regarding which contradictions can be rational and emotional. In the first case, the confrontation is based on the sphere of the rational. It usually involves the processing of social and managerial structures, as well as liberation from unnecessary forms of cultural interaction. Emotional conflicts are characterized by a strong affective aspect, often aggression and the transfer of appropriate reactions to subjects. Such a conflict is more difficult to resolve, because it affects the sphere of the personal and can hardly be settled in rational ways.

Intergroup social conflicts: concept and functions

Social psychology considers mainly intergroup conflicts, which can be divided into:

  • socio-economic;
  • interethnic;
  • Ethnic
  • ideological;
  • political;
  • religious;
  • military.

Each conflict has a dynamics, in accordance with this intergroup clashes can occur spontaneously, planned, short or long, they can be controlled and uncontrollable, provoked or proactive.

Conflicts cannot be viewed only from a negative point of view. The positive functions are to accelerate the process of self-awareness, the establishment of certain values, the discharge of emotional tension, etc. Social conflict indicates a problem that needs to be solved, which cannot be simply closed eyes. Thus, the clash contributes to the regulation of social relationships.

Ways to Get Out of Conflict

How can social conflicts be resolved? The concept of a way out of them is characterized by the end of the confrontation by various methods. Allocate:

  • rivalry - upholding one's convictions to the last;
  • adaptation - the adoption of a foreign point of view to the detriment of one's own;
  • avoidance - avoiding a conflict by any means;
  • compromise - willingness to make concessions to resolve the situation;
  • cooperation - the search for a solution that satisfies the interests of all parties to the conflict.

The latter method is the most constructive and desirable.
